Cooking method for a cooking appliance including a stirring means, and corresponding cooking appliance

1. A cooking method for a cooking appliance comprising a single holding means provided to hold ingredients, a stirring means arranged inside the single holding means, at least one main heating means, at least one ventilator powered by a motor for generating a heating flow, the single holding means and the stirring means being designed to be animated with a relative rotation at a certain speed, the appliance comprising at least one interface for control of the relative rotation, of the at least one main heating means, and of the at least one ventilator powered by the motor, the cooking method comprising:
an initial step in which at least first type of ingredient is arranged according to a specific arrangement in one of at least two separate cooking zones of the single holding means and, simultaneously at least second type of ingredient is arranged according to a specific arrangement in a second one of the at least two separate cooking zones, where the one of the at least two separate cooking zones is at least in part but mainly directly underneath the heating flow;
a first cooking step during which the relative rotation of the single holding means and of the stirring means is neutralized, the at least one main heating means is controlled in order to regulate the temperature at a first set-point value, and the at least one ventilator powered by the motor is controlled in order to regulate the heating flow at a first circulation speed, such that the at least first type of ingredient arranged in the one of the at least two separate cooking zones at least in part but mainly directly underneath the heating flow is subject to a greater heat gain than the at least second type of ingredient arranged in the second one of the at least two separate cooking zones; and
a second cooking step during which the relative rotation of the single holding means and of the stirring means is active at a first speed of relative rotation of the single holding means and of the stirring means such that the at least first and second types of ingredients arranged in the one and the second one of the at least two separate cooking zones are mixed, and the at least one main heating means is controlled in order to regulate the temperature at a second set-point value, greater than or equal to the first set-point value, and the at least one ventilator powered by the motor is controlled in order to regulate the heating flow at a second circulation speed.
